Comprehensive Guide to virginia quitclaim deed template
What is the Virginia Quitclaim Deed Template?
The Virginia Quitclaim Deed Template is a legal document specifically designed for transferring property ownership in Virginia. This form facilitates the transfer process between parties, ensuring a clear record of ownership change. The significance of using this document lies in its legality, which protects the interests of both the grantor and grantee involved in real estate transactions.
Utilizing the Virginia Quitclaim Deed Template serves as an efficient Virginia property transfer form, allowing individuals and organizations to complete property transactions smoothly and accurately.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them
Filling out a quitclaim deed can lead to errors if not approached carefully. Common mistakes include:
-
Incorrectly identifying the grantor and grantee
-
Leaving mandatory fields blank
-
Misspelling names or addresses
To prevent these errors, it is crucial to double-check all information before submission, ensuring accuracy and compliance with legal standards.

Who is eligible to use the Virginia Quitclaim Deed Template?
Any property owner or authorized representative, such as a corporate officer, can use the Virginia Quitclaim Deed Template to transfer property ownership in Virginia.
Are there any deadlines for submitting the quitclaim deed?
There are typically no strict deadlines for submitting a quitclaim deed, but it is advisable to record it promptly to ensure clear property ownership and avoid disputes.
How do I submit the completed quitclaim deed?
Once completed, the quitclaim deed should be signed by both parties and may need notarization. Then, the signed document can be recorded with the local county clerk's office.
What supporting documents do I need to provide with the quitclaim deed?
You may need to provide identification for the grantor and grantee, proof of property ownership, and any prior title documents, depending on local requirements.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the quitclaim deed?
Be sure to double-check names, property descriptions, and required signatures. Missing or incorrect information can result in delays or rejection of the deed.
How long does processing take for a quitclaim deed?
Processing times can vary by county, but it often takes a few days to weeks for the local authority to record and return the quitclaim deed.
